What is CPR?

Cardiopulmonary resuscitation (CPR) is an emergency lifesaving treatment executed when the heart stops beating. It includes breast compressions and rescue breaths to maintain blood circulation and oxygenation up until innovative clinical assistance shows up. Comprehending how to do CPR properly is important for anyone that may locate themselves in a position to assist someone in distress.

Why is mouth-to-mouth resuscitation Important?

CPR is important since it assists keep blood flowing to the brain and various other vital organs throughout cardiac arrest. The quicker mouth-to-mouth resuscitation is launched, the greater the chances of survival. Understanding Cardiac Arrest

What Triggers Cardiac Arrest?

Cardiac arrest happens when the heart instantly quits pumping blood successfully. This can be as a result of different reasons, consisting of:

    Heart disease Drowning Severe trauma Drug overdose Electrical shock

Recognizing these reasons can help you comprehend the urgency of executing mouth-to-mouth resuscitation when necessary.

The Basics of Performing CPR

Adult CPR Guidelines

Step-by-Step Instructions

Check Responsiveness: Shake the person delicately and yell loudly. Call for Help: If there's no reaction, telephone call 000 immediately for emergency assistance. Positioning: Make certain the person is lying level on their back on a firm surface. Open Airway: Tilt their head back slightly by placing one hand on their forehead while raising their chin with an additional hand. Check Breathing: Try to find upper body motion and pay attention for breathing sounds. Start Breast Compressions:
    Kneel next to them. Place heel of one hand on the facility of their chest. Place your other hand on top; interlock fingers. Keep arms straight and shoulders directly over hands. Compress a minimum of 5 centimeters deep at a rate of 100-120 compressions per minute.
Rescue Breaths (if trained):
    After 30 compressions, provide 2 breaths utilizing a pocket mask or mouth-to-mouth if safe. Continue cycles of 30 compressions complied with by 2 breaths.
Use AED if available: Comply with prompts from an Automated External Defibrillator (AED).

Incorrect Compression Depth

One common mistake throughout adult mouth-to-mouth resuscitation is making use of a wrong compression depth-- much less than 5 centimeters or more than 6 cm may not be effective sufficient or could trigger injury. Always go for between 5 centimeters and 6 cm.

CPR for Unique Situations

Infant CPR Technique

Performing baby mouth-to-mouth resuscitation calls for certain methods as a result of their size:

Check Responsiveness: Delicately tap the baby's foot or shoulder. Call for Help: Call emergency solutions while guaranteeing security first. Positioning: Lay them on a company surface on their back. Open Airway: Make use of a neutral placement as opposed to tilting their head back as well far. Check Breathing: Observe routine breathing patterns closely. Chest Compressions:
    Use 2 fingers put just listed below the nipple area line at a deepness of about 4 cm at a price comparable to grownups-- 100-120 compressions per minute.
Rescue Breaths:
    Give 2 gentle breaths after every 30 compressions; make certain no obstruction occurs.

Drowning Victims

For sinking sufferers, it's important first to obtain them out of water securely before starting mouth-to-mouth resuscitation:

Follow typical mouth-to-mouth resuscitation steps yet emphasize rescue breaths because they could not be breathing because of water inhalation.

Ensure airways are clear by turning the head backwards prior to starting rescue breaths.

Utilizing AED with CPR in Australia

What is an AED?

An Automated External Defibrillator (AED) is made to assess heart rhythms and provide electrical shocks as required during cardiac arrest situations.

How To Utilize AED

Turn on the AED device; follow voice motivates offered by it meticulously. Expose the upper body location where pads will be placed. Attach pads according to representations revealed on pads or tool instructions-- one pad over appropriate breast bone and one more below left armpit. Ensure nobody touches the client while analyzing rhythm-- clear everybody away! If shock advised, press 'shock' button when motivated; return to breast compressions quickly after shock delivery.
